191. Deputy Marcella Corcoran Kennedy asked the Minister for Agriculture, Food and the Marine the reason a person (details supplied) in County Offaly will have to repay all moneys they received through REP scheme 4 on lands which they had been leasing 14.35ha, said lands having now been sold in recent months; if an appeal will be allowed in this case;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[19653/13]
